A very different presentation of the now-infamous Pontius Pilate and his interaction with Judea, the Sanhedrin and Jesus Christ. Palestine is a land split by those who support the Roman enemy occupation and the fanatics determined to undermine it. A new leader emerges: Jesus. Pilate is drawn as the down-to-earth career soldier with a job to do – make Judea a productive, thriving outpost of the Roman Empire. There are vivid, unforgettable portraits of the mad Emperor Tiberius, the corruption of Caiaphas and Annas, the fanatical Zealots and the scheming Herod.
